Transaction 0385798dad72fffca95fde80038c91bca944883f4ea593ea249ebb988bc9f536

1 Input
2 Outputs
  • 0385798dad72fffca95fde80038c91bca944883f4ea593ea249ebb988bc9f536:0
  • value  100534663
    address  3LcoEbkwucH3JzHbjbas2KfgvKkeNa61fR
  • 0385798dad72fffca95fde80038c91bca944883f4ea593ea249ebb988bc9f536:1
  • value  556310319
    address  1GoRvWKvPtmZLwCoRcr7qd89XH59iXY7QQ